Is > this module simply to interface with the messenger or does it replace it? > At any rate after compiling and installing trunk/PROTO/shotgun I get this > message when trying to load the module: > > http://www.enlightenment.org/ss/e-50bd0c44095376.90003578.jpg > > What am I missing here? latest svn > > > On Mon, Dec 3, 2012 at 2:03 PM, Michael Blumenkrantz < > michael.blumenkra...@gmail.com> wrote: > > > hokay, 24 hours later and sawed-off is pretty functional so I'll explain > > it a bit here. > > > > I use xmpp pretty actively. given this, one of the more common things that > > I do in my workflow is to switch to some chat window to read chat, click > > links, or talk to people. > > > > enter the shotgun:sawed-off module for e17. with shotgun running (and > > connected) and this module loaded, you can easily do those things without > > ever changing window focus or workspaces. this module is contained in the > > shotgun source tree and is built automatically if its dependency, edbus2, > > is detected at compile time. > > > > on loading the sawed-off module, the first thing (and only thing) you'll > > need to do is create (key)bindings for the actions. the important ones are > > "Toggle Reply Entry" and "Toggle First Link". > > > > "Toggle Reply Entry" - this action shows, at a position of your choosing > > from the associated config dialog, a small popup. this popup contains a > > contact name, their icon, and a text entry. while open, pressing enter will > > send the current entry text to the named contact as though you were typing > > in their chat window (meaning it lets the gui do all the heavy lifting when > > it comes to determining which presences to send to). > > when open, the popup will grab keyboard focus. this can be disrupted if an > > e menu is opened. simply activate the binding again to hide it. the > > following keys are reserved when the entry is shown: > > * Escape - hide the popup > > * Return/KP_Enter - send current text to displayed contact > > * ctrl+alt+{left,right} - cycle through online contacts in order of > > message frequency (clears entry text) > > > > "Toggle First Link" - this action shows, at a position relatively close to > > (hopefully, depending on your elm version) the position of the shotgun > > contact list, the tooltip for the last link sent. this behavior can be > > modified to ignore links that you have sent in the config dialog. adding a > > method to open links in web browser is also planned, but not currently > > implemented. > > no keys are reserved when a tooltip is shown; activate the binding again > > to hide it. > > > > I don't think I left anything out, so have fun blasting each other to > > virtual bits on the internets! > > > > ------------------------------------------------------------------------------ LogMeIn Rescue: Anywhere, Anytime Remote support for IT.
